HTTP persistent connection, also called HTTP keep-alive, or HTTP connection reuse, is the idea of using a single TCP connection to send and receive multiple HTTP requests/responses, as opposed to opening a new connection for every single request/response pair. See more All modern web browsers including Google Chrome, Firefox, Internet Explorer (since 4.01), Opera (since 4.0) and Safari use persistent connections.
